软件双击没有反应,每隔一段时间便提示SoftBusdevicenotrunning.这个怎么解决?
最佳答案
1、不同的驱动是为了支持不同的协议,例如S7-1613是为了支持S7协议,他可以完成和西门子S7系列的200、300、400PLC的以太网通讯,PG-1613是把CP1613作为编程器可以和用于PLC的编程调试。
2、SOFTNET-S7(InduSTrialEthernet)与SOFTNET-S7(PROFIBUS)分别是指基于以太网和基于PROFIBUS的S7通讯,如果你是用CP1613、CP1612或者其他普通的以太网卡,那么用的就是SOFTNET-S7(IndustrialEthernet),如果你用的是CP5611、CP5512等RS485网卡,,那么用的就是SOFTNET-S7(PROFIBUS)。
3、如果你用到PCSTATioN功能,授权应该是需要的,看你用的网卡应用的是哪种协议,那么就需要相应的授权,如果没有授权,那么PCSTATION会有相应的对话框提示你没有授权,但是你仍然可以使用。安装的都是SimaticNet软件,驱动程序已经随SimaticNet安装了。SimaticNet的授权有很多,都是针对不同的通信协议,例如,使用CP1613和S7-300/400通信,就需要S7-1613的授权;使用CP5611和S7-300/400通信,就需要SoftNet-S7PB的授权,无论使用PCStation组态与否,最好都购买授权,因为没有授权,有可能无法达到较多的连接数
4、SIMATICNETPC软件里包含所有西门子网卡的所有协议驱动,另外包括PCSTATION组态软件,另外还有一些相关文档。
5、S7RTM(站点管理器)是一个SIMATICNET组件,它支持与STEP7V5.2有关的PC站的“LoadTargetSystem”特性。如果PC-Station>ObjectProperties>Configuration中的复选框处于激活状态,你可以禁用他试试。安装了SimaticNet之后,每次登录Windows后,StationConfigurationEdtior的启动是有些慢,这是SimaticNet的*病,SCE要扫描并装载已经下载到本地的组态信息,和CP1613没有关系。楼主如果想禁用SCE的启动项,可以选择“开始”–“运行”,输入msconfig,选择“开始”(Startup)选项页,禁用条目s7wnsmgx,重启即可。
需要检查“控制面板”–“管理工具”–“计算机管理”中的“设备管理器”,在SimaticNet项目下的SimaticSoftbus是否正常,如果没有,则需要重新安装驱动,在“控制面板”–“添加新硬件”中添加新设备,驱动选择SimaticNet下的SimaticSoftbus。
参考资料:http://www.ad.siemens.com.cn/service/answer/solution.ASp?Q_ID=31085&cid=1027
提问者对于答案的评价:
谢谢